Bruins Face Off Against Golden Knights: Key Highlights

Alex Steeves has emerged as a key player for the Boston Bruins, a journey marked by perseverance and hard work. Initially left off the Bruins’ opening night roster, Steeves transitioned from the AHL to the NHL by early November. His tenacity paid off when he earned a two-year contract extension this past Wednesday, highlighting not just his skills but the trust the organization has in him as a player.

“It is just really a special feeling. Appreciative that they believe in who I am as a person and as a player and my potential,” Steeves commented on the contract. This extension not only solidifies his place in the team but also exemplifies a culture of recognition within the Bruins organization.

Strategic Positioning within the Team

Steeves is set to play alongside Fraser Minten and Morgan Geekie during the upcoming match against the Vegas Golden Knights, part of the Hockey is for Everyone Night at TD Garden. His versatility has made him an essential asset for head coach Marco Sturm as he can be deployed in various roles throughout the game.

Sturm emphasized the importance of Steeves’ journey, stating, “He is a good guy to have for me, personally, because I trust him and I can put him in any situation.” This trust not only reflects on Steeves’ work ethic but also underscores a larger trend in modern hockey: organizations are increasingly valuing players who exhibit a willingness to evolve and adapt.
